Female fall victim with dislocated ankle treated near Oak Park Surgery Center, Arroyo Grande CA
A 31-year-old woman fell and dislocated her ankle in the parking lot near Oak Park Surgery Center. She is feeling dizzy and is by a white Tesla. Emergency medical services responded to the scene.
